In 2026, the entertainment and popular media landscape has shifted from a "volume-first" model to a more calculated, technology-driven ecosystem. Major players like Netflix and YouTube are converging, with streamers pivoting toward fewer, high-impact releases to battle subscriber fatigue while relying on artificial intelligence (AI) to create hyper-personalized viewer experiences. Core Media & Platform Trends
Audiences are increasingly fragmented, moving away from mass-broadcast models toward niche, community-driven content.
The Convergence of Giants: Netflix and YouTube are adopting each other's playbooks; YouTube is pushing more "premium" episodic content, while Netflix integrates more short-form and mobile-centric advertising.
Cable 2.0 Bundling: To combat "subscription overload," major platforms are increasingly offering multi-service bundles that bring fragmented apps under a single payment and interface.
Social Search & Discovery: Traditional search is fading as users treat TikTok and Instagram as primary discovery engines. Platforms like TikTok now prioritize intent-based search over passive scrolling. Content Types & Consumption Habits
Modern storytelling is becoming shorter, more immersive, and highly authentic.
Vertical Video as a Primary Pipeline: Studios now treat vertical, short-form video as a legitimate development pipeline for new intellectual property (IP), rather than just a marketing tool.
Limited Series Dominance: Audiences are gravitating toward self-contained, high-budget limited series over multi-season franchises that risk burnout.
Live & Immersive Experiences: Live sports and concerts are becoming interactive, using AR/VR to let viewers watch from "spatial" first-person views or sit court-side virtually. The Role of AI in Entertainment

Entertainment content and popular media have become an integral part of modern life, shaping the way we think, feel, and interact with each other. From movies and television shows to music, social media, and video games, the entertainment industry has evolved into a multi-billion-dollar market that caters to diverse audiences worldwide. This essay will explore the impact of entertainment content and popular media on society, highlighting both the positive and negative effects of this influential sector.
On the one hand, entertainment content and popular media have the power to inspire, educate, and unite people across cultures and geographical boundaries. Movies and television shows can raise awareness about social issues, promote empathy, and spark meaningful conversations. For instance, films like "12 Years a Slave" and "The Pursuit of Happyness" have shed light on historical injustices and encouraged discussions about racism and inequality. Similarly, popular music artists like Kendrick Lamar and Beyoncé have used their platforms to address social issues, such as police brutality and feminism.
Moreover, entertainment content has the ability to bring people together, creating a shared experience that transcends cultural and socio-economic divides. Sports events, concerts, and festivals have become essential aspects of modern entertainment, fostering a sense of community and social bonding. Social media platforms, such as Instagram and Twitter, have also enabled people to connect with each other, share experiences, and participate in online discussions.
On the other hand, the impact of entertainment content and popular media on society has also been criticized for its negative effects. The proliferation of violent and explicit content in movies, television shows, and video games has raised concerns about desensitization and the promotion of aggression. Studies have shown that exposure to violent media can lead to increased aggression, anxiety, and depression in children and adults alike. Furthermore, the objectification of women and minorities in popular media has perpetuated stereotypes and contributed to a culture of sexism and racism.
The spread of misinformation and fake news through social media has also become a pressing concern. The ease of sharing unverified information has led to the dissemination of conspiracy theories, propaganda, and disinformation, which can have serious consequences for individuals and society as a whole. The role of social media in shaping public opinion and influencing electoral outcomes has been particularly contentious, highlighting the need for greater accountability and regulation in the digital media landscape.
In addition, the commercialization of entertainment content has led to the homogenization of cultures and the suppression of diverse voices. The dominance of Hollywood and Western popular culture has raised concerns about cultural imperialism, with many local cultures and art forms being marginalized or erased. The lack of representation and diversity in entertainment content has also been criticized, with underrepresented groups seeking more inclusive and authentic storytelling.
In conclusion, entertainment content and popular media have a profound impact on society, influencing the way we think, feel, and interact with each other. While they have the power to inspire, educate, and unite people, they also perpetuate negative stereotypes, promote aggression, and spread misinformation. As the entertainment industry continues to evolve, it is essential to recognize both the benefits and drawbacks of entertainment content and popular media, and to strive for a more responsible, inclusive, and diverse approach to storytelling.

The Evolution of Play: How Modern Media Redefines Entertainment
In an era defined by rapid digital transformation, the boundaries between content and consumer have never been more blurred. From the rise of immersive streaming platforms to the cultural dominance of social media "micro-entertainment," the way we spend our leisure time is undergoing a radical shift. The Shift from Passive to Participatory
Gone are the days when entertainment was a one-way street. Today's popular media thrives on participation.
Social Connectivity: Platforms like TikTok and Instagram have turned every user into a potential creator, fostering a "culture of connectivity" where engagement is as valuable as the content itself.
Immersive Experiences: The industry is moving beyond the screen. According to EY's 2025 trends, "location-based entertainment"—such as branded theme park districts and interactive theatrical performances—is becoming a primary revenue driver. Technology as the Great Accelerator
Technological advancements aren't just changing how we watch; they're changing what we watch.
Streaming Dominence: US audiences are increasingly favoring streaming video services (SVOD) and gaming over traditional pay TV.
The Power of Data: Companies like Netflix use sophisticated data analysis to tailor content to specific audience niches, ensuring that every recommendation feels personal.
